    Edit: So I was doing some experimenting with viper, and in the corner, this combo is really effective.
    Jump Kick/Jump Punch/Focus Attack, Crouching Hard Punch, EX Seismic Hammer, Heavy Thunder Knuckle, Burst Time. 619 damage with Jump Punch I know, but I forget the other damages.

    Good games Pete.

    Out of those characters, I'd say that Honda is probably your best option, but Guile is a good option if you can play him very aggressively. I find that Honda is better suited to punish air teleports better than Guile (Guile's only real option is flash kick and maybe his standing punch but that's not consistent enough). Once you score a knockdown, stay extremely aggressive and mix it up so Dhalsim doesn't know what's coming next. And obviously if you get him in the corner, do everything you can to keep him there. At best, his teleport will only get him right behind you and you can do an easy throw back into the corner. I also posted about the Blanka-Dhalsim matchup a few pages ago.
